Energy efficient Energy efficient fridge freezers consume less energy, allowing you to save money and reduce your carbon footprint. Over the years, manufacturers have made significant improvements to their energy-efficient appliances. They have raised the insulation standards, introduced high-efficiency evaporators and compressors, and added features such as defrosting, temperature control and defrosting. Today, most new white goods come with an energy rating that you can see on the appliance itself as well as on the online store listings. The energy efficiency is usually color-coded, with A being the most efficient and G the lowest. A fully-stocked freezer uses more energy than one that's empty. It's a good idea purchase a freezer thermometer for a reasonable price and monitor your food and beverages to keep them at the ideal temperature for storage. It is recommended to maintain an average temperature of between 3 and 5 degrees Celsius in your refrigerator and minus 18 or less than 20 degrees Celsius in your freezer. Some models have an adjustable hinge that allows you to choose the side you'd like to open the door, based on your kitchen's layout. Check for ENERGY STAR when shopping for a refrigerator freezer. This is a government-endorsed label that indicates that the appliance is at least 10 percent more efficient than the federal minimum standard. This can significantly reduce your energy bills so it's a great idea to look at ENERGY STAR models to find the most affordable price.
